Summary:
There is no need to generate expensive file history stream if only one node is requested.
I refactored code that generated stream of history commits, so it'd first yield the nodes and only then prefetch their parents. That will help to solve latency problem for the history request for only a single commit.
I removed BFS queue and added two state variables: ready nodes and already processed:
* The last are the nodes that were return as a part of a history stream on the last iteration and now can be used to construct next BFS layer: prefetch fastlog batches, fill the commit graph, take parents in BFS order to form new bunch of nodes.
* First are used if it's the first iteration - there is no processed nodes yet but there are some that are ready to be returned.
I believe removing the queue I simplified the code and logic a little bit.

Summary:
Currently if derivation of a particular derived data type is disabled, but a
client makes a request that requires that derived data type, we will fail with
an internal error.
This is not ideal, as internal errors should indicate something is wrong, but
in this case Mononoke is behaving correctly as configured.
Convert these errors to a new `DeriveError` type, and plumb this back up to
the SCS server. The SCS server converts these to a new `RequestError`
variant: `NOT_AVAILABLE`.

Summary:
This allows code that is being exercised under async_unit to call into code
that expects a Tokio 0.2 environment (e.g. 0.2 timers).
Unfortunately, this requires turning off LSAN for the async_unit tests, since
it looks like LSAN and Tokio 0.2 don't work very well together, resulting in
LSAN reporting leaked memory for some TLS structures that were initialized by
tokio-preview (regardless of whether the Runtime is being dropped):
https://fb.workplace.com/groups/rust.language/permalink/3249964938385432/
Considering async_unit is effectively only used in Mononoke, and Mononoke
already turns off LSAN in tests for precisely this reason ... it's probably
reasonable to do the same here.
The main body of changes here is also about updating the majority of our
changes to stop calling wait(), and use this new async unit everywhere. This is
effectively a pretty big batch conversion of all of our tests to use async fns
instead of the former approaches. I've also updated a substantial number of
utility functions to be async fns.
A few notable changes here:
- Some pushrebase tests were pretty flaky — the race they look for isn't
deterministic. I added some actual waiting (using pushrebase hooks) to make
it more deterministic. This is kinda copy pasted from the globalrev hook
(where I had introduced this first), but this will do for now.
- The multiplexblob tests don't work at all with new futures, because they call
`poll()` all over the place. I've updated them to new futures, which required
a bit of reworking.
- I took out a couple tests in async unit that were broken anyway.
